Frindsbury, a parish in the Medway area of Kent.
29 Jul 1839 Marriage solemnized at the parish church in the parish of Frindsbury in the County of Kent
No. When Married. Name and Surname. Age. Condition. Rank or Profession. Residence at the Time of Marriage Father's Name and Surname Rank or Profession of Father Twenty Caleb COOMBS, of full Bachelor Laborer Frindsbury Thomas Coombs Laborer #168 ninth of age June 1839 Sarah TURNER of full Spinster -- Frindsbury Daniel Turner Laborer age
Image at Medway Archives & Local Studies Centre.
